Clean Sweeps Across All The Various Vets Classes
Like old soldiers, it seems, motocross stars of yesteryear also do not grow old and weary. Laurence Binyon's poem "For the Fallen", perhaps known to many who hear it each year on Anzac Day as the Ode of Remembrance, immortalised the words " Age shall not weary them, nor the years condemn" and those words could well be used to describe the many "old soldiers of motocross" who battled at the 2017 New Zealand Veterans' and Women's Motocross Championships near Eltham at the weekend.
